The CUET Mass Media paper is part of the Domain-Specific Subjects under Section II of the CUET UG exam. The syllabus is structured into seven comprehensive units, each focusing on a key component of mass communication such as journalism, advertising, cinema, radio, social media, and new media technologies.These topics are aligned with contemporary trends and NCERT-recommended themes to ensure candidates gain a strong foundational understanding of media studies.
Here’s the unit-wise syllabus for CUET 2026 in Mass Communication:
Meaning and types of communication
Relationship between culture and mass media
Representation and stereotyping in media
Communication as a tool for social change
Role of media in social movements
Qualities of a good journalist: curiosity, ethics, language, empathy
Ethical issues in journalism: fake news, paid news, plagiarism, defamation
Freedom of speech and journalistic responsibility

A. Advertising
Concept, functions, and types of advertising
Advertising formats: cross-promotion, merchandise, covert advertising
B. Television
Pre-production: scripting, planning
Production and post-production stages
Role of producer and director
Writing and scripting for radio: conversational tone, simplicity
Radio studio equipment: microphones, mixers, speakers
Basics of radio production and transmission
History of cinema (Lumière Brothers, Phalke, etc.)
Genre theory and types: comedy, drama, action, sci-fi, etc.
Cinema and social change: parallel cinema and issues-based filmmaking
Definition and types of platforms
Role in democracy and cyber activism
Cybercrime: bullying, trolling, online fraud
Importance of digital etiquette (netiquette)

Internet as a convergence point for mass media
Changing media landscape due to digital platforms
New media and democracy
Rapid opinion generation and global information exchange
Emerging trends in digital communication
Understanding the CUET exam pattern for mass media is crucial to effective preparation.
Parameter |
Details |
Exam Mode |
Computer-Based Test (CBT) |
Question Type |
Objective (Multiple Choice Questions) |
Total Questions |
50 (All Compulsory) |
Total Marks |
250 |
Duration |
60 minutes |
Marking Scheme |
+5 for correct, -1 for incorrect |

Start by going through the complete CUET Mass Media syllabus and exam pattern. Focus on major units like Journalism, Advertising, Cinema, Social Media, and Communication. Understand the weightage of each topic to prioritize your study time.
Use NCERT textbooks, reference books like R. Gupta’s Mass Communication Guide, and curated study material by top coaching platforms. Download the CUET Mass Media syllabus PDF and ensure your preparation is syllabus-aligned.
Divide your study hours efficiently. Allocate specific days for each unit and keep buffer time for revision and mock tests.
Solve CUET sample papers, previous year question papers, and take mock tests regularly. This helps improve your speed, accuracy, and time management skills.
Since the exam may include media and communication-related questions, stay updated on media trends, famous journalists, recent campaigns, and events.
For students aiming at journalism or media courses, enhancing communication, public speaking, and writing skills can be a bonus during interviews or college admissions.
In the last few weeks, revise using summary notes, key facts, and quick reference sheets. Focus on CUET Mass Media important topics list and concepts that are frequently asked.
